Grafana图总计数显示为列表?
Posted
技术标签:
【中文标题】Grafana图总计数显示为列表?【英文标题】:Grafana graph total count shown as list? 【发布时间】:2020-02-15 03:14:43 【问题描述】:我有一个 Grafana 仪表板,目前我的查询显示为“仪表”图表,显示总点击量。
正如您在屏幕截图中看到的那样,它显示了点击总数 - 但我希望将它们列在一个列表中,其中包含每次点击的详细信息(不是 Kibana 方式)。
我查看了 Grafana 提供的其他一些图形模型,“表格”模型是我认为最好的模型,但它只显示“时间”和“计数”列,这不是有用。
有什么方法可以操作表格上显示的列,所以不是“时间”和“计数”而是更多的自定义值?
或者其他人有更好的方法吗?
我已经看过 Grafana here 提供的教程/指南,但我发现它们的细节很少。 我还尝试拉出“原始文档”以查找我想要显示的 JSON 列,但随后它崩溃了,我收到与 Grafans github here 中报告的错误消息相同的错误消息说
“Grafana 可能已更新。请尝试重新加载页面。”
嗯...老实说非常令人沮丧。
// 简而言之:我想从显示在 JSON 中的查询中添加一些指标,我可以根据需要将其放入表中。
2019 年 10 月 22 日更新 关于 Grafana 的错误信息
“Grafana 可能已更新。请尝试重新加载页面。”
将它更新到最新版本 6.4.3 解决了这个问题,即使它本应在 6.4.2 中修复。
这使我能够看到原始 JSON 格式的数据,这样就完成了。现在我需要了解如何在 JSON 中获取和处理其中一些数据,以便我可以在表格中看到它们。
【问题讨论】:
【参考方案1】:发现我只需要使用指标“唯一计数”或“计数”,从中选择一个索引指标,然后给我一个计数值。
请仔细检查您得到的不是平均值,而是总数。如果 fx 显示 0.4 而你只有整数,那么你可能得到一个平均值。
此外,如果您想使用不同的指标,以便它们显示在面板中,一个解决方案是选择指标“原始文档”。然后在可视化中,您可以选择添加要在“列”下显示的指标。按“+”标记并添加不同的指标。
如果你想给它一个更好的名字,你可以在“列样式”下进行配置。
最后 - 始终保持最新使用最新的 grafana 版本,这样您就不会因为没有更新而出现的错误而沮丧。
【讨论】:
以上是关于Grafana图总计数显示为列表?的主要内容,如果未能解决你的问题,请参考以下文章
如何描述显示 systemd 单位的 grafana 仪表板
制作每日重置的 InfluxDB/Grafana 累积函数(锯齿图)